ajax跨域,cookie,session失效的问题解决办法 后台设置:response.setHeader("Access-Control-Allow-Credentials","true");response.addheader("Access-Control-Allow-Origin",request.getHeader("Origin"));response.addheader("Access-Control-Allow-Methods","POST
Ajax 简介 文章转载自Roblarsen,文章原地址:Ajax简介主流Web编程模式的历史实践和当前实践在过去几年,JavaScript已从让人事后才想起的偶然对象变成最重要的Web语言。如果要指出一个推动这项技术显著进步的因素,那就是基于Ajax的应用程序开发的出现。Ajax简史Ajax的发展历史类似于其他许多一夜成名的技术。该API是大多数Ajax交互的核心,也是现代Web开发的一项基本技术。先锋除了Microsoft之外,还有其他一些企业开始进军原型Ajax领域。这三项Ajax技术的使用使得Web开发界沸腾起来
AJAX入门篇 AJAX入门篇这是我第一次接触Ajax这门技术,未免不感到陌生,故记录我的学习过程,以供未来人参考。这样说来,那么AJAX的功能就是用来完成页面的局部刷新,而不中断用户的体验。AJAX既然称之为异步的JavaScriptAndXML,那么XML代表什么呢?AJAX是使用XML做为数据传递的格式的,但实际上数据格式可以由JSON代替,进一步减少了数据量。
Ajax中POST和GET的区别 当然在Ajax请求中,这种区别对用户是不可见的。在某种情况下,GET方式会带来严重的安全问题。POST用于创建资源,资源的内容会被编入HTTP请示的内容中。一个比较实际的问题是:GET方法可能会产生很长的URL,或许会超过某些浏览器与服务器对URL长度的限制。*若使用GET方法,则表单上收集的数据可能让URL过长。
AJAX中使用post,get接收发送数据的区别 W3C建议我们使用get获取数据,使用post发送数据。所以有种说法说post更安全。get传递数据时,直接在浏览器地址栏中可以看到;而post可以使用开发者工具中看到。get传递数据的最大量为4kb;而post通过设置服务器可以为无限大。get传递的数据,中文会被编码或有可能出现乱码;而post不会。get在IE下会走缓存;而post不会
ajax以get和post方式请求 post方式是把form表单的数据给请求出来以xml形式传递给服务器1、ajax之get方式请求①在url地址后边以请求字符串形式传递数据。效果图:2、ajax之post方式请求①给服务器传递数据需要调用send方法②调用方法setRequestHeader()把传递的数据组织为xml格式③传递的中文信息无需编码,特殊符号像&、=等需要编码④该方式请求的同时也可以传递get参数信息,同样使用$_GET接收该信息效果图:
extjs异步刷新技术Ext.Ajax.request 关于Ext.Ajax.request,值得注意的就是它的请求方式,目前笔者用的是extjs3.0的版本,所以关于之后的版本怎么样没有进行研究,不过这个请求方式是一定得是大写的,然后直接报错或者利用默认请求方式‘GET’的请求,即便你写成‘post’是没有用的,如果你想要用post请求,必须是大写的形式:‘POST’。请求成功后sucecss:function,这里最好放进一个response响应的对象,可以从这个对象中获取result的值,如下。